A stasis field was a device used for preservation. It worked by altering the passage of time within the area subject to the field; usually either by slowing the passage of time, or stopping it all together. During the High Republic Era, the Jedi Order, on the Wild Space planet Mulita, defeated the Great Progenitor, the leader of the carnivorous plant Drengir species, by capturing her in a giant stasis field.[1] In 5 BBY,[2] The corpse of Jedi Master Luminara Unduli was stored in a stasis field in the Spire on Stygeon Prime.[3] Statis fields where installed on Syliure-31 hyperspace docking rings to ensure that the pilots only aged as fast as the rest of the galaxy.[4]

Stasis fields could also be used to preserve living organisms, such as flowered plants.[5]
